SoundTools CTMX Overview

The CAT Tails MX from SoundTools allows four lines of balanced analog audio, AES/EBU, DMX, and Clear-Com signals to be run down a shielded etherCON/Cat 5/6/7 cable hundreds of feet away. The CAT Tail is a fully passive unit that supports 48V phantom power and can be used for input directly into analog or digital consoles. Each channel is isolated, which means channel 1 can send a DMX signal while channel 2 is sending balanced analog all down the same shielded Cat 5 cable.

Additionally, the CAT Tails extension system consists of a male XLR sender and a female XLR receiving unit (both sold separately). This allows you to send four XLR audio signals thru a Cat 5/6/7 cable hundreds of feet away and convert it back to the four XLR balanced analog audio, AES/EBU, DMX, and Clear-Com signals.
